The other day in language class, our instructor, Falau, was explaining to us why Santo is such a civilized island.

"Here," he said, "you can buy a bride for 100,000 Vatu (roughly a thousand dollars), which is better than some of the other islands where you trade for a bride."

On the island of Pentecost, for example, you can get a bride for the incredibly low price of one woven mat. On Erromango, all you need to do is find a few Navelak. Navelak, it turns out, are rocks pushed up through the soil by unknown means, which are used for currency.

Brings a whole new meaning to the term "rock bottom price!"

Some of you single men might say, "I don't have 100,000 Vatu, nor do I have any woven mats and I can't find any more than "small change" gravel." Well, worry not! In the Big Bay region of Santo, (where Steven and Kara Jaegar are stationed), all it takes is a promising hunting dog!

If you happen to have a spare pig lounging about, you can trade it for a wife on Ambrym or Paama.

"No livestock," you say. Well, you need look no further than the Banks Island group in Northern Vanuatu. There, you can buy yourself a wife for a simple necklace of seashells!
